Devine dropped down to 3-3-1 on Tuesday, ending the team's three-game streak of wins. They lost 10-4 to the La Vernia Bears. The pitching woes were uncharacteristic for the Warhorses / Arabians, who until this game were averaging four runs allowed.
Devine saw five different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Sam Zamora, who went 1-for-3 with two stolen bases, one run, and one RBI. Another was Karsyn Mann, who went 1-for-3 with one home run and two RBI.
As for La Vernia, they moved to 2-4 with that win, which also ended their four-game losing streak. With that victory, they brought their scoring average up to 6.5 runs per game.
On La Vernia's side, Addison Lundin sp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ered four earned runs on six hits and racked up six Ks.
On the hitting side, La Vernia let Makayla Soriano and Makenzie Soriano run wild. Makayla went 2-for-4 with one home run, three runs, and three RBI, while Makenzie went a perfect 4-for-4 with three RBI, two doubles, and one stolen base. That's the most doubles Makenzie has posted since back in April of 2025. Hailey Calton also deserves some recognition as she launched her first home run of the season.
